Economic Advantages of Laser Printers

The cost-effectiveness of laser color printers is another important feature to consider. While the initial investment in a laser printer may be higher than that of an inkjet printer, the overall cost of ownership is often lower over time. This is due to the longer lifespan of laser toner cartridges, which can last for thousands of pages before needing replacement, and the lower cost per page when compared to inkjet cartridges. The durability of laser toners means that you can print large volumes of documents without the need for frequent refills, reducing both time and money spent on maintenance.

Additionally, laser printers typically have lower energy consumption, which can further reduce operating costs. This makes them an eco-friendly choice for businesses and households that are concerned about energy efficiency and environmental impact. In the long term, the cost-effectiveness of laser printers can justify their higher initial purchase price, making them a smart investment for anyone who needs to produce large volumes of high-quality prints regularly.
